Re: default drive?

The default drive code uses pwm 13 - 16. pwm 13 and 14 are side of the robot and 15 and 16 are the other side. Here's the code if your interested.

pwm13 = pwm14 = Limit_Mix(2000 + p1_y + p1_x - 127);
pwm15 = pwm16 = Limit_Mix(2000 + p1_y - p1_x + 127);
